    How to make a giant aluminum ant nest

    The internets have been abuzz with this photo today (Click for the full size version). It’s a photo of an aluminum cast of an ant nest made by Walter Tschinkel, a Florida entomologist–but there haven’t been a lot of additional details. The nest you are looking at is one of a Florida harvester ant, and appeared with many other photos…

    July 30th is the birthday of Regnier de Graaf (1641 – 1673), a Dutch anatomist who made several important contributions to reproductive biology. He was the first to describe the reproductive function of the Fallopian tube and its role in infertility, and he also invented the syringe. Does Pop Sound Louder, Dumber, and More and More the Same?
